OBITUARY
MRS. GEORGE McKINLEY. =
The many friends' of Mrs. George McKinley will regret to hear of her death, which occurred .shortly after 9 o'clock on Wednesday night. The deceased, who was- only- 29 vears of age, had, unfortunately, been very ill for the past two and a lialf years, but she bore her .ill^ ness with great fortitude, never complaining. The late Mrs. McKinley was the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. D:Hodges, of Otaki, and had- been a resident of the town for the past six years, during which time she made many friends by her bright and cheerful nature. She was educated at Wellington East Girls' College and proved an apt'pupil. A husband and iittle daughter, besiaes other relatives,- are left to mourn their loss. Much sympathy has been extended to the bereaved.
